Probabilistic Hybrid Knowledge Bases Under the Distribution Semantics

Since Logic Programming LP and Description Logics DLs are based on different assumptions the closed and the open world assumption, respectively, combining them provides higher expressiveness in applications that require both assumptions. Several proposals have been made to combine LP and DLs. An especially successful line of research is the one based on Lifschitz's logic of Minimal Knowledge with Negation as Failure MKNF. Motik and Rosati introduced Hybrid knowledge bases KBs, composed of LP rules and DL axioms, gave them an MKNF semantics and studied their complexity. Knorr et al. proposed a well-founded semantics for Hybrid KBs where the LP clause heads are non-disjunctive, which keeps querying polynomial provided the underlying DL is polynomial even when the LP portion is non-stratified. In this paper, we propose Probabilistic Hybrid Knowledge Bases PHKBs, where the atom in the head of LP clauses and each DL axiom is annotated with a probability value. PHKBs are given a distribution semantics by defining a probability distribution over deterministic Hybrid KBs. The probability of a query being true is the sum of the probabilities of the deterministic KBs that entail the query. Both epistemic and statistical probability can be addressed, thanks to the integration of probabilistic LP and DLs.

[1]  I. Horrocks,et al.  A Tableau Decision Procedure for $\mathcal{SHOIQ}$ , 2007, Journal of Automated Reasoning.

[2]  Fabrizio Riguzzi,et al.  The distribution semantics for normal programs with function symbols , 2016, Int. J. Approx. Reason..

[3]  José Júlio Alferes,et al.  Query-Driven Procedures for Hybrid MKNF Knowledge Bases , 2013, TOCL.

[4]  Sergio Greco,et al.  Logics in Artificial Intelligence , 2002, Lecture Notes in Computer Science.

[5]  Ian Horrocks,et al.  A Tableaux Decision Procedure for SHOIQ , 2005, IJCAI.

[6]  Fabrizio Riguzzi,et al.  The PITA system: Tabling and answer subsumption for reasoning under uncertainty , 2011, Theory Pract. Log. Program..

[7]  Evelina Lamma,et al.  Probabilistic logic programming on the web , 2016, Softw. Pract. Exp..

[8]  Evelina Lamma,et al.  Tableau Reasoners for Probabilistic Ontologies Exploiting Logic Programming Techniques , 2015, DC@AI*IA.

[9]  Evelina Lamma,et al.  A Distribution Semantics for Probabilistic Ontologies , 2011, URSW.

[10]  Boris Motik,et al.  A Faithful Integration of Description Logics with Logic Programming , 2007, IJCAI.

[11]  Luc De Raedt,et al.  ProbLog Technology for Inference in a Probabilistic First Order Logic , 2010, ECAI.

[12]  Thomas Lukasiewicz,et al.  P-SHOQ(D): A Probabilistic Extension of SHOQ(D) for Probabilistic Ontologies in the Semantic Web , 2002, JELIA.

[13]  Ian Horrocks,et al.  Description Logics , 2008, Handbook of Knowledge Representation.

[14]  Guy Van den Broeck,et al.  Open World Probabilistic Databases (Extended Abstract) , 2016, Description Logics.

[15]  Maurizio Lenzerini,et al.  Informal Proceedings of the 27th International Workshop on Description Logics, Vienna, Austria, July 17-20, 2014. , 2014 .

[16]  Taisuke Sato,et al.  A Statistical Learning Method for Logic Programs with Distribution Semantics , 1995, ICLP.

[17]  Nils J. Nilsson,et al.  Probabilistic Logic * , 2022 .

[18]  Rafael Peñaloza,et al.  Bayesian Description Logics , 2014, Description Logics.

[19]  Franz Baader Description Logics , 2009, Reasoning Web.

[20]  Boris Motik,et al.  Reconciling description logics and rules , 2010, JACM.

[21]  Thomas Lukasiewicz,et al.  Probabilistic Default Reasoning with Conditional Constraints , 2000, Annals of Mathematics and Artificial Intelligence.

[22]  Ricardo Gonçalves,et al.  Normative Systems Represented as Hybrid Knowledge Bases , 2011, CLIMA.

[23]  Thomas Lukasiewicz,et al.  Tractable Reasoning with Bayesian Description Logics , 2008, SUM.

[24]  Georg Gottlob,et al.  Conjunctive Query Answering in Probabilistic Datalog+/- Ontologies , 2011, RR.

[25]  Andrea Calì,et al.  Tightly Coupled Probabilistic Description Logic Programs for the Semantic Web , 2009, J. Data Semant..

[26]  Maurice Bruynooghe,et al.  Logic programs with annotated disjunctions , 2004, NMR.

[27]  Joseph Y. Halpern An Analysis of First-Order Logics of Probability , 1989, IJCAI.

[28]  David Poole,et al.  The Independent Choice Logic for Modelling Multiple Agents Under Uncertainty , 1997, Artif. Intell..

[29]  Evelina Lamma,et al.  A web system for reasoning with probabilistic OWL , 2017, Softw. Pract. Exp..

[30]  Vladimir Lifschitz,et al.  Nonmonotonic Databases and Epistemic Queries , 1991, IJCAI.

[31]  Evelina Lamma,et al.  Learning Probabilistic Description Logics , 2014, URSW.

[32]  Thomas Lukasiewicz,et al.  Expressive probabilistic description logics , 2008, Artif. Intell..